#149b33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#149b33 is composed of 7.8% red, 60.8%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 133.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 34.3%. #149b33 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ff66 with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

● #149b33 color description : Dark lime green.
#149b33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#149b33 has RGB values of R:20, G:155,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1350451.

Shades and Tints of #149b33
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021005 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#149b33
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575857 is the less saturated color, while #07a82c is the most saturated one.
